prostate

[/ˈprɑːsteɪt/]
nounfemininepl: prostates
próstata
1. A gland in the male reproductive system that produces seminal fluid and surrounds the urethra below the bladder
The prostate gland plays an important role in male fertility.
A glândula próstata desempenha um papel importante na fertilidade masculina.
2. The tissue or organ that can be affected by cancer, enlargement, or infection in men
Regular screening for prostate cancer is recommended for men over 50.
O rastreamento regular do câncer de próstata é recomendado para homens acima de 50 anos.
